Mission and Vision:

The Parikh Foundation is a result of decades of involvement by 

Drs. Sudha and Sudhir Parikh in education and health initiatives in India, building U.S- India relations, as well as in furthering the opportunities available to Indian immigrants as they settled in this country.

The Parikh Foundation is dedicated to bringing about change in the lives of marginalized communities in both India and the United States.

With more than a million dollars donated to worthy causes and organizations, Drs. Sudha and Sudhir Parikh hope to take philanthropy to the next level - building partnerships with sister organizations interested in uplifting the poor and marginalized communities whether in Mumbai or Miami; Gujarat or Georgia; Maharashtra or Mississippi. Alabama or Andhra Pradesh.

With the dual tragedies of COVID-19 and its effect on India and the U.S., as well as the death of George Floyd in Minnesota, we are even more energized to engage in furthering equality and social justice goals in our country of birth and our adopted country.

We see a window of opportunity to work more closely with US-based partners, to implement development projects that benefit marginalized Americans in inner cities and rural areas as well as in villages in India; share experiences; learn from each other, and contribute skills and strategies to overcome poverty and build self-sustaining communities that offer a superior standard of living.
